look up any word, like plopping:

1 definition by Slick Rick 'Tha Ruler'

The plastic remains of a tampon after insertion.
Jeff: Yo dude, WTF is wrong with your toilet!?

Pat: This stupid fucking broad tried flushing her bitch whistle down the goddamn toilet and clogged that bastard!

Jeff: That's fucking weak....and gross dude.
by Slick Rick 'Tha Ruler' April 02, 2010